Kitten Growth Chart
Wondering whether your small kitten is developing normally ? Monitoring their stature can offer valuable information into their overall condition. A standard kitten growth chart acts as a helpful guide to assess if your furry friend is following the correct course . While individual discrepancies are completely natural , knowing the typical milestones can enable you to recognize any possible concerns sooner and ask for professional assistance. Here's a quick glimpse at what to expect :
- Initial Weight: Typically around 3-4 ounces.
- One Week Old: May double in size .
- Fortnight Old: Eyes should be fully visible .
- 28 Days Old: Beginning to explore .
- 56 Days Old: Typically weighing approximately 2-3 pounds.
Keep in mind that these indicate guidelines , and the individual growth might deviate. Be sure to check with your veterinarian about any specific anxieties you have .
Welcoming Home a Kitten : Securing & Early Nurturing Guidance
So, you're planning to receive a kitten into your life! Providing a forever home is a fantastic experience. Before you jump in, proper preparation is key. Start by baby-proofing your house : put away hazardous substances, cover electrical cords , and secure fragile items. A calm space, like a small area, is ideal for the initial adjustment period. Let's look at a few important aspects to remember:
- Provide fresh hydration and food specifically formulated for kittens .
- Allow your small friend to explore at their own rhythm.
- Arrange a appointment with a veterinarian for preventative care and a complete health examination.
- Gradually familiarize your kitten to other companions in the family .
- Be compassionate – adjusting to a new environment takes adjustment.
Remember, adopting a baby cat is a significant responsibility , but the companionship they bring is immeasurable !
Nurturing a Well Kitten: Crucial Milestones & Development
Your newborn kitten's early months are brimming with significant milestones! Observe rapid growth , with weekly change revealing new abilities. From their eyes around ten days to taking first unsteady steps, and then moving on to proper playtime, it’s a beautiful period. Transitioning to wet food typically starts around six weeks, together with exploring their surroundings. Avoid forgetting essential socialization – introducing them to diverse sights, sounds here , and individuals is essential for a balanced adult cat.
